I'm about to do all my filters and oil and need a bit of info. I've never done a fuel filter before but have been told it is best to fill the new one with new diesel or a diesel treatment to ensure the system won't need bleeding. Is this correct and if so is it best to just use diesel or a diesel treatment?

5 min job just pop off pipes (use rag to make sure no spillage from pipes/lines)
put new one in
re attach
start engine

never had prob either no stutter nothing
